When I logged into my FlickR account, someone had emailed me from a month ago... Saying they wanted to put my "Blind Rage" photograph of Storm into their book which would only be published in Ireland. They were going to make 1,500 copies of the same photograph.

I said no... Didn't feel like it was true mainly because the guy said he wasn't going to pay me. I understand we are all struggling with finance and the economy's so bad it's not funny, but for someone to just use my picture 1,500 times without me getting any money just didn't sound right. Did I make the right choice?
